The Dallas Cowboys are bringing in linebacker Willie Harvey Jr. for a workout, according to Tom Pelissero of the NFL Network. Harvey played for the St. Louis BattleHawks of the United Football League (UFL) this spring and finished the 2024 season with 78 tackles, and four sacks in 10 games, leading the league in tackles. The 28-year-old also led all linebackers in tackles for loss (nine) passes defended (six) and forced fumbles (two). His production led to him being named to the All-UFL Team. Rocco Becht and the We Will Collective are teaming up to give back through NIL. The Iowa State quarterback is hosting a youth football camp on July 13 in Perry, Iowa – using his NIL dollars cover all costs, the NIL collective announced Wednesday. The free camp will be open to fifth through eighth graders and take place at Perry High School, and Becht is also planning to donate to Perry Community Schools with his NIL earnings. The Green Bay Packers signed former Iowa State wide receiver Dimitri Stanley after watching him in action during rookie minicamp. The signing was announced on Monday, and Stanley is the son of former Packers wide receiver Walter Stanley who was with the team 1985-1989. Along with adding Dimitri Stanley to the roster, the Packers signed former Central Michigan wide receiver Julian Hicks and former Virginia Tech offensive lineman Lecitus Smith. Athletes at Iowa and Iowa State filed a lawsuit Friday regarding an alleged violation of rights in the state’s gambling investigation. Multiple athletes were at the center of the inquiry and lost their eligibility as a result. The lawsuit includes 26 athletes – 16 from Iowa and nine from Iowa State, along with one more from a local community college – argued investigators violated constitutional rights by using a geolocation software to track their cell phone activity.
